pwrupbut.asm

来自「VCP201_CODE is a FPGA source code.」· 汇编 代码 · 共 38 行

ASM
38
字号
;----------------------------------
; pwr_up_but_chk:
; check the power-up button status,
; SEL+START --> l-r-axis swap
; L2+R1+O --> load default values.
;----------------------------------
pwr_up_but_chk:
	movf	pb_raw0,W
	xorlw	RESET_PB0
	btfss	STATUS,Z
	goto	check_swap
	movf	pb_raw1,W
	xorlw	RESET_PB1
	btfss	STATUS,Z
	goto	check_swap
	bsf	f_reset_ram
	
check_swap:
	movf	pb_raw0,W
	xorlw	SWAP_PB0
	btfss	STATUS,Z
	goto	end_pwr_up_but_chk
	movf	pb_raw1,W
	xorlw	SWAP_PB1
	btfss	STATUS,Z
	goto	end_pwr_up_but_chk
	bsf	f_alt_vr
        movlw   BEEP_1          	;BEEP 1 TIMES
        call    p_beep
        	
end_pwr_up_but_chk:
	btfss	p1d,7
        bsf	f_arcade

	return
			
	

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?